Shell Helix Ultra 5W-40

Shell Helix Ultra 5W-40 Packshot
- 5W-40 Fully synthetic motor oil.
- Cleans and protects for maximum performance.
- It is five times as effective at removing sludge than mineral oil
Shell Helix Ultra Suitability
- High performance modern petrol engines
- Fuel-injected models fitted with catalytic converters
| Shell Helix Ultra Features and Benefits | |
|---|---|
| Features | Benefits |
| Shell's ultimate active cleaning technology | Provides the best engine protection by continuously removing deposits from dirty engines |
| Long-term oxidation stability | Up to 37% more protection than other synthetic leading brands tested |
| Low viscosity, rapid oil flow and low friction | Greater fuel efficiency and easier cold starting |
| High shear stability | To maintain viscosity and stay in grade throughout the oil drain period |
| Specially selected synthetic base oils | Reduces oil volatility and therefore oil consumption. The need for oil top-up is therefore reduced |
| Minimises vibration and engine noise | Smoother, quieter drive |
| Shell Helix Ultra Specifications | |
|---|---|
| Viscosity | 5W-40 |
| API | SM/CF |
| ACEA | A3/B3/B4 |
| BMW | LL-01 |
| MB | 229.5 |
| VW | 502 00 / 503 01 / 505 00 |
| Renault | RN0700, RN0711 |
| Porsche | Approved |
| Ferrari | Approved |
Shell Helix Ultra Racing 10W – 60
Shell Helix Ultra Racing has been formulated with a higher viscosity to provide better bearing protection under extreme performance and racing conditions.
| Shell Helix Ultra Racing | ![]() Shell Helix Ultra Racing 10W – 60 | |
|---|---|---|
| Features | Benefits | |
| Specially designed for racing and modified vehicles | Greater bearing and wear protection under extreme performance and racing conditions | |
| Shell ultimate active cleansing technology | Five times as effective at removing sludge from dirty engines than a mineral oil | |
| Long-term oxidation stability | Up to 37% more protection than other fully synthetic leading brands tested | |
| Low viscosity, rapid oil flow and low friction | Greater fuel efficiency | |
| High shear stability | To maintain viscosity and stay in grade throughout the oil drain period | |
| Specially selected synthetic base oils | Reduces oil volatility and therefore oil consumption. The need for oil top-up is therefore reduced | |
| Minimises vibration and engine noise | Smoother, quieter drive | |
